Micron Technology is a world leader in innovating memory and storage solutions that accelerate the transformation of information into intelligence, inspiring the world to learn, communicate and advance faster than ever.

As a Smart Systems Engineer at Micron, you will be at the forefront of innovation in our semiconductor manufacturing environment across High Bandwidth Memory (HBM), Component Assembly and Test, and SSD operations. Collaborating with a multi-functional team, you will provide system solutions to improve operational productivity, efficiency, and product quality while driving cost reduction initiatives. Your role will encompass problem analysis, system development and building, vendor management, production testing, know-how training, and commissioning of solutions. You will define software specifications and research, develop, document, modify, and support software throughout the development process.  

Responsibilities and Tasks 

  • Provide solutions to meet operational needs to drive down manufacturing cost and cycle time while improving product yield and quality. Solutions may include both internal Micron applications and third-party vendor applications. 

  • Explore opportunities to introduce new systems, including AI-powered analytics and automation tools, to improve organizational efficiency through system solutions. 

  • Conceptualize, plan, and improve user interaction and engagement by conducting detailed analysis and understanding of application performance and user experience. 

  • Build user interfaces that use insights from data analysis, incorporating visual, technical, and functional elements to ensure ease of access, intuitive understanding, and seamless usage. 

  • Develop and maintain software applications using Micron-approved software languages, databases, standard tools, and solutions that promote reliability, maintainability, and portability of codes. 

  • Analyze gaps and proactively introduce measures to improve the efficiency of existing systems by keeping abreast of the latest AI technologies. 

  • Apply project management to lead projects and collaborate with business users and IT to define requirements, resolve issues, and carry out improvement and development efforts. 

  • Coordinate, build, and manage the health of databases. Establish backup and recovery requirements and maintain documentation and procedures. 

  • Own and govern assigned enterprise applications as system lead, accountable for ensuring availability and performance. 

  • Provide active leadership to drive the group to higher levels of proficiency. Mentor peers or less experienced team members. Develop training materials and provide training and mentorship. 

Job Requirements, Qualifications/Experience:  
  • Master's/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ent experience in Computer, Electrical, or Electronics Engineering, Computer Science, or Computing 

  • Familiar with the practical usage of AI technologies and tools (M365 Copilot), experience in AI agent creation is an advantage 

  • Proficient in programming languages (Python, C#, ASP.net, SQL, Angular, HTML, etc.) 

  • Knowledge in database technologies (Microsoft SQL, Oracle, Snowflake, etc.) 

  • Good understanding of software development methodologies and the full software development life cycle 

  • Familiar with collaborative tools like GIT 

  • Strong analytical, logical, and critical thinking skills 

  • Effective communicator, able to collaborate across all levels 

  • Growth mindset with a passion for continuous learning 

  • Internship or experience in the semiconductor industry is a plus 

  • Demonstrated leadership and a track record of impact are highly desirable 

  • Interest in and knowledge of the semiconductor industry and Micron

About Micron Technology, Inc.

We are an industry leader in innovative memory and storage solutions transforming how the world uses information to enrich life for all. With a relentless focus on our customers, technology leadership, and manufacturing and operational excellence, Micron delivers a rich portfolio of high-performance DRAM, NAND, and NOR memory and storage products through our Micron® and Crucial® brands. Every day, the innovations that our people create fuel the data economy, enabling advances in artificial intelligence and 5G applications that unleash opportunities — from the data center to the intelligent edge and across the client and mobile user experience.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
